VMware has a tool to convert a physical drive to Virtual that can then
be used on any VMware vm host. its free as it does promote you to use
their solutions.

I have used it on windows hosts with amazing effect.

> Yes you can.  Will you have the Virtual machine server already running on
> the Apple? Or will we need to do that as well.  It would probably help if
> you had your existing /home or /home/<user>/ available on an external
> drive.  Your existing userid, password, and user id number from the Dell
> could also be handy.  Or just bring the Dell with you.
